A universal divergence rate for symmetric Birkhoff Sums in infinite ergodic theory

Zemer Kosloff

Published 2014-12-03Version 1

We show that there exists a universal gap in the failure of the ergodic theorem for symmetric Birkhoff sums in infinite ergodic theory. In addition, an application of this result to a question of fluctuations of the Birkhoff integrals of horocyclic flows on geometrically finite surfaces is given.
